When Did the Messenger of Allah ﷺ Establish a Civil State?!

Mahmoud Al Junaid, newly appointed on 05/11/2019 as Deputy Prime Minister for the “National Vision for the Modern Yemeni State”, disclosed for the first time the term ‘civil state’, where he stressed in a meeting with the Ministers of Transport Zakaria al-Shami, the local administration Ali al-Qaisi, and the civil service Idris Al-Sharajbi, on Tuesday 19/11/2019, that “the rapid response of institutions to implement the directives of the President of the Supreme Political Council reflects the keenness to fight corruption, enhance transparency and proceed with building a civil state free from corruption and corrupt persons,” Al-Thawra Daily Newspaper in Yemen reported on Wednesday 20/11/2019.

For nearly a year, the Houthis have been using the term “modern state,” giving hopes for their followers that the Qur’anic path will only establish a state governing by Islam. They remained silent on the term civil state since the issuance of the draft vision on 29/01/2019 until its approval by the political council on 26/03/2019, and its continued promotion in various media, preferring to use the word ‘modern state’. This is the first time that an official spokesman discloses about the Houthis intention to establish a civil state, in a clear unequivocal way.

A civil state is a Western ruling term that denotes a state where religion has no place in its provisions, legislation and laws. Rather, it excludes and leaves religion to individuals to freely follow a religion or not. This is what is seen by those who read the Vision endorsed by the Supreme Political Council.
